Structural
Almost all Iranian anti-theft door metal structures are made of bent sheet. And iron cans are also used to strengthen the structure. In order to make the Iranian anti-theft door structure, the raw sheet that has good bending properties is used. that the minimum ST for the desired sheet should be 12. This type of sheet is one of the preferred types in Iran by companies such as Foulad Mobarakeh and Haft Almas. After the desired sheet arrives at the anti-theft door manufacturing factory, the parts are cut in the desired sizes and then punched and instead of locks and fittings are prepared on it. Anti -theft door internal structure
One of the most important and fundamental components of anti-theft doors is the internal structure of the anti-theft door. This part is the real material or anti-theft door sash. All other components can be installed on it as well. It is necessary to remember that the higher the quality and strength of the structure, the higher the security of anti-theft doors. The most important materials that will be used in the production and modeling of the structure are metal coils, steel plates, metal belts and others.

Tips to be observed in the construction of the door -by -door
In making the door structure, it is necessary to pay attention to the following:
Using high quality and durable steel sheets
Steel has high resistance; Therefore, using it in the construction of the door structure increases the security of these doors.
Using quality welding electrodes to connect steel sheets
In fact, the function of the electrode is to connect the steel sheets and profiles used in the structure, and the higher the quality of these electrodes, the longer the durability and resistance of the parts connected in the structure increases.
The first type of door structure:
The door structure is made in such a way that a metal coil is made around the steel profile. Then, a steel sheet with a thickness of 0.7 to 1.25 mm, which is already made in a sinusoidal shape, is welded on this coil. This sinus coil is mainly used on the outside of the door and the door facing the external environment.
This sinusoidal sheet will increase the resistance of the door against bending or possibly the force of the door used by thieves for theft. It should be noted that in some production models, a steel sheet with a thickness of 0.7 to 1.25 mm is welded in the opposite direction of the mentioned steel coil.
The second type of door structure:
The door structure is made with a metal coil with steel profiles. It should be noted that the type and size of this profile is determined depending on the thickness of the door. Then, in order to make the door more resistant to bending, 3 to 4 steel bars with exactly the same size as the peripheral profiles are welded horizontally to two vertical peripheral profile bars, then a steel sheet with a thickness of 0.7 to 1.25 mm is welded on this coil. to be
It should be noted that exactly like the sinusoidal structure (first type) in some production models, a steel sheet with a thickness of 0.7 to 1.25 mm is welded in the opposite direction of the indicated steel coil.
